ALMS: Robertson Racing Ford GTR in mid-build
 
Robertson Racing has posted some pictures of their upcoming ALMS ride, a GT2 class Ford GT-R in mid build. The team's first choice was a Ferrari 430 GT, but being unable to get one, they chose the Doran-built Ford GT-R. They plan to run 1 car, driven by the husband and wife team of Andrea and David Robertson, along with David Murray. A 2nd car, to be piloted by two pro drivers is also in the works.

As you can see, the car still has quite a ways to go in its transformation into a GT2 class race car. It still has its stock supercharged engine which will be replaced by a Yates/Roush sourced Nascar-based V8 for the race car. It's also still running stock brakes, and many other stock components that will be replaced with racing parts by the time the car is completed.

I'm not expecting much from the Robertson's as they're by no means pros and they're going up against the best in the world, but it's great to see people with such a great spirit and passion for sports car racing!

ALMS: No GT2 Vipers for 2008...
 
Dodge has been forced to revise their anticipated support of potential American Le Mans GT2 entrants for 2008. Citing workforce reductions in the wake of budgetary constraints after the Cerberus takeover, SPEEDtv.com has learned factory engineering and financial support of the projected 3-5 Dodge Viper Competition Coupes anticipated for 2008 has been tabled for a possible green light in 2009.

Those entries, all privateer, had been waiting on confirmation from Dodge as to the level of support they would receive in the manufacturer-driven American Le Mans Series. The majority of those privateers are expected to pass on a GT2 program without manufacturer support akin to what their Porsche and Ferrari rivals enjoy.

Primetime Race Group owner/driver Joel Feinberg, having previously announced his entry for the 2008 American Le Mans season, remains unaffected.

Feinberg and co-driver Chapman Ducote made their series debut in Detroit in 2007, with Feinberg preparing in both the SPEED World Challenge GT series and the IMSA Lites category before making the leap to ALMS GT2.

ALMS: Mazda Power for Quifel Team ASM Lola in 08
 
LMP2 stalwarts in the European Le Mans Series will run their LMP2 Lola B05/40 with a Mazda MZR-R powerplant in 2008. They will also be bringing in some new drivers in the form of Oliver Pla or Filipe Albuquerque.

The Mazda engine, a turbocharged 2.0L inline-4 built by AER has shown great strength in the B-K Motorsports LMP2 Lola in the ALMS in its first year, leading the race overall for some time at Mosport this past season. They've had to deal with reliability and teething issues that always come with a new engine, but AER claims the bugs have been worked out, and even more go fast goodies in the form of direct injection and a variable geometry turbocharger will be ready for the engine sometime this season.

I think this engine package is easily as strong as any out there.

Highcroft Racing announces exciting changes for the 2008 American Le Mans Series (ALMS) season. Scott Sharp will be joining the team and partnering with Le Mans-winning driver, David Brabham, with Patrón Spirits as the team’s title sponsor. Patrón Spirits is the distiller of Patrón Tequila, the world’s number-one selling ultra-premium tequila. The team will be known as Patrón Highcroft Racing. Highcroft Racing is a factory-backed team which campaigned an Acura ARX-01a in the LMP2 class in the 2007 ALMS season.

Duncan Dayton, Team Principal of Patrón Highcroft Racing, said, "I am truly excited to announce the partnership between Patrón Spirits and Highcroft Racing’s Acura program in the ALMS. Our ability to attract Patrón Spirits is a testament to the hard work that Highcroft has put in over the past 18 months and our results on the track. This partnership represents a significant milestone for this young team and for the ALMS."

Dayton continued, "The team is delighted to welcome Scott Sharp to the Patrón Highcroft Racing family. Scott comes from a long line of sports-car racers and holds strong family ties to the Connecticut area. In fact, some of our team members worked for the original Newman-Sharp teams over 20 years ago. Scott’s distinguished career in the Indy Racing League certainly bodes well for a successful partnership with Patrón Highcroft Racing, Acura and David Brabham."

In moving from the IndyCar Series to the ALMS, Scott Sharp’s career has come full circle. Sharp began racing sports cars in the beginning of his professional career, and is returning to the arena once again. Sharp has won nine IndyCar events and has 35 top-five finishes in the Series. He holds the record of 138 consecutive IndyCar starts. In 1996, he was the IndyCar Series co-champion and also won the 24 Hours of Daytona. He is also a two-time Trans-Am champion, winning 15 races over three seasons.

Patrón Highcroft Racing's David Brabham said, "I am really looking forward to the next season racing for the Patrón Highcroft Racing team and driving with Scott. I believe Scott will be a great addition to the team. I had a fantastic time working with Highcroft and Acura last year and I am honored to continue as one of their drivers. Highcroft came in ahead of the other Acura teams last year, and as drivers, Scott and I will be pushing not only to be the lead Acura team, but also to be at the front of the P2 class in 2008."

David Brabham raced in Formula One, Formula 3000 and Formula 3 before becoming one of the world’s leading sports car racers in the American Le Mans Series and the famed 24 Hours of Le Mans. He took top honors at the 2007 24 Hours of Le Mans driving an Aston Martin. David is the only American Le Mans Series driver to have taken the pole in all four Series classes. He won the 12 Hours of Sebring in 2005 and 2006 in the GT1 class. Other notable career victories include the Bathurst 1000, which he won with his brother, Geoff, in 1997, the 24 Hours of Spa in Belgium and the Macau Grand Prix, where he defeated Michael Schumacher.

Patrón Highcroft Racing also announced that Stefan Johansson, who was David Brabham’s teammate last season, will be joining the team again for the two endurance events - the 12 Hours of Sebring and Petit Le Mans. One of the most experienced drivers in all of motorsports, Stefan Johansson has competed in everything from Formula One and Champ Cars to prototype sports cars, with great success in every division. Notable career achievements include winning the 12 Hours of Sebring twice, in 1984 and 1997, and an overall victory at the 24 Hours of Le Mans in 1997 with Joest Racing. Stefan drove full time for Highcroft in the 2007 season and helped the team take third place in the LMP2 championship.

Duncan Dayton welcomed Stefan Johansson back, saying, "We are thrilled to have Stefan joining Patrón Highcroft Racing for the 12 Hours of Sebring and Petit Le Mans. His long, successful career and his results for Highcroft last year speak for themselves. We're looking forward to having his experience in the Acura program contribute to our efforts in 2008."

Founded in 1989, Highcroft Racing started as a vintage racing and restoration company and moved into the modern racing arena a few years later. Both the racing team and restoration company are housed in a state-of-the-art 48,000 square foot shop in Danbury, Connecticut.
